406 MHz satellite distress beacons Part 1: Marine emergency position - indicating radio beacons (EPIRB) (IEC 61097-2:2002, MOD)

Superseded date

30-06-2017

Published date

08-05-2003

Proposes to provide manufacturers, suppliers and testing facilities of 406 MHz satellite distress beacons with the minimum radiofrequency and environmental requirements and associated test methods to enable design and confirmation of compliance with Australia and New Zealand radiofrequency spectrum and maritime regulatory requirements.
